Work shops - Practical innovation

Systematic innovation

The workshope focuses on teaching a set of systematic thinking tools and developing new products and/or processes with them. The purpose of this workshop is to provide the company's employees with a set of skills required to think innovativly. During the workshop we will practice these tools and develop innovational ideas for the product/process selected.



The workshop includes:

  • Thinking patterns - Identification and analysis.
  • Using constraints as a key principlein the innovation process.
  • The "Immediate world" principle.
  • Thinking tools (Based on TRIZ method).
  • Implementing the above on a chosen product/process.
